Should Shedeur Sanders be the Cleveland Browns QB1? LeBron James thinks so
Cleveland might have a new star on the verge of taking over the city, and one of it’s hometown heroes is all aboard the Shedeur Sanders train.

Cleveland has been in need of a quarterback for a long time. Basically their entire existence as an NFL franchise. It’s early, but Shedeur Sanders shined in his debut from Carolina on Saturday night, and he caught the attention of Cleveland’s most famous homegrown hero.
The King crowns Shedeur
After getting dumped down the draft board into the fifth round of the selection show back in April, Shedeur Sanders heard nothing but negativity about his attitude, his decision making and his ability to play the game he loves. In his NFL debut against the Carolina Panthers he finally got a chance to silence those critics while making a big statement to all of the teams that passed up on him just a few months ago.
With a handful of quarterbacks vying for a roster spot injured, the former Colorado Buffalo QB got the start and showed out under the bright lights. He came into the stadium like only Deion’s son could do, blasting his own song, with an entourage behind, one of them with a sickle in his hand. Had he had a bad game, the media would have ripped him to shreds. Instead he crushed it in his first outing with the Browns, and people immediately went to social media to laud him with praise.

The most noteworthy of all of those supporters was Cleveland’s own LeBron James. The King went to Twitter during the game and all but crowned Shedeur the next King of Cleveland. “That young (king emoji) looking good out there! @ShedeurSanders Keep going up!!! HEAD down on the grind and HEAD high to the most hight.”
Sanders shines in debut
Among the others to heap praise on Shedeur for his debut was his dad Deion, University of South Carolina women’s basketball coach Dawn Staley, KC Chiefs wide receiver Xavier Worthy and Nike, who used a picture of Shedeur with a fantastic slogan saying “When you get your opportunity, create your next one.”
That’s exactly what Shedeur did against the Panthers. He went 14/23 for 138 yards and two touchdowns. His arm looked strong, and accurate. He used his legs when he needed to and had a couple of spectacular scrambles out of pressure and showed tremendous pocket presence in his first game out of college. When asked about LeBron’s and the rest of the worlds love on social media, Shedeur kept is short and sweet, “That’s love. ... I’m playing for a lot of people and a lot of beliefs.”

There is still a lot of work to be done for Shedeur who still needs to make the 53 man roster before he can think about being the starter or even the next star in Cleveland. There are currently five QBs on the roster, but if Sanders keeps improving throughout the regular season, it’s going to give Coach Kevin Stefanski plenty to think about come Week 1.
